Braidwood Nuclear Power Stations Units 1 and 2 Braidwood Station Security Plan NRC Docket Nos. 50-456 & 50-457 TAC Nos.*'6]i215/65276 Enclosed is the original and three (3) copies of Revision 28 of the Braidwood Nuclear Power Station Security Plan. Commonwealth Edison Company (CECO), Braidwood Station has made a decision to reconfigure its access facility.
The purpose of this reconfiguration is to focus the ingress screening area to one location for all access.
This will provide for a cost benefit to CECO as well as effectively utilize security personnel for access control.
CECO is requesting formal approval to modify Braidwood's approved Security Plan Figures 6-1 and 5-15 to reflect these changes.
The change involves the face of the southwest side of Braidwood's access facility.
The doors of the section will be modified to form a barrier similar to the existing wall.
The current barrier is constructed of concrete, 4
concrete block or concrete block and brick. All portions of the barriers are constructed from floor to ceiling and present a formidable deterrent to anyone attempting unauthorized or undetected access.
Penetrations of 96 square inches or greater that exist for ventilation ducts or pipes will be equipped with accepted barrier material to reduce the opening (s) to less than 96 square inches.
The " bricked in" doorways of the southwest side of the access facility'and the area which continues inside the gatehouse to the exit turnstiles does now-form the Protected Area (PA) barrier, This area, as.previously agreed to by NRC Inspectors, will not have a perimeter intrusion detection system (PIDS) or an isolation zone associated with its configuration.
The new barrier (southwest front wall) and existing inside barrier'(wall) will not allow unauthorized or undetected access to the PA.. An attempt to drill. cut, chisel or break through the barrier will be detected / observed.
A camera will be mounted on the south face of the gatehouse overlooking the west end (new PA boundary) of the building. Additionally, the camera will provide enhanced coverage for the existing microwave zones of vehicle search and the warehouse delivery area.
Response to unauthorized activity will be in-the same manner as other dispatches from the security control centers.

A meeting in October of 1992 with NRC Inspectors at the Regional Headquarters took place to discuss this approach in which verbal concurrence was obtained. Additionally, a site visit in January of 1993 by the Region III Plan Reviewer took place by which agreement was also reached. As a result, this requet. is being submitted as a 50.54(p) change to the approved Braidwood Security Plan.
In addition, this revision reflects the current station organizational structure as it applies to the Security Department.
Pursuant to 10CFR 50.4, the signed original and three copies of the security plan revisions are being provided to your office.
A copy of this letter and two copies of the security plan revisions are being sent to Region III.
He have concluded that these changes do not decrease the safeguards effectiveness of the plan. These enclosures contain Safeguards Information which must be protected from public disclosure pursuant to 10CFR 73.21.
